New research reveals soaring energy bills are set to be felt acutely in places where Conservatives secured slender majorities in 2019, due to the concentration of inefficient housing stock in those areas
Above average levels of energy inefficient housing in marginal constituencies could see energy efficiency become a pivotal issue at the next general election, a new analysis has suggested. Research...
